Have any Vintage Straight Shaving Photos?
I'm thinking of putting a few vintage photos on the wall in my shave den and I wondered if anyone had any nice vintage photos they would be willing to share with the members.I will post the ones I have.Most came from public use photos in the Library of Congress web pages.I was hoping members from other countries would have access to some we haven't seen.

I can't help noticing in the old Barbershop photos that regular customers had their own shaving mug and brush stored on shelves so that you get to use your own soap each time the barber would shave you.More sanitary too.
